REST API
Use the Stixify REST API to build custom integrations, enrich internal workflows, and move structured intelligence into the tools your team already uses.
Overview
The Stixify REST API is the most flexible way to integrate Stixify into your environment.
It gives teams direct access to structured intelligence extracted from unstructured content, making it easier to build custom tooling, support analyst workflows, and connect Stixify to the rest of the stack.
Why teams use the REST API
The REST API is a strong fit when you want more control over how Stixify data is used.
That can include:
- building internal search or enrichment tools
- pulling structured intelligence into analyst dashboards
- surfacing related report intelligence inside case or incident workflows
- correlating Stixify data with internal detections or sightings
- supporting AI agents with structured CTI inputs
Example use cases
- Create a lookup service that takes an IoC and returns related Stixify reports and extracted objects.
- Enrich a triage workflow with ATT&CK, observable, or report context.
- Build an internal research portal that lets analysts search extracted intelligence alongside internal data.
- Feed structured report intelligence into an automation or agent workflow.
When to choose REST API
Choose the REST API when you want a custom workflow, application, or integration that is shaped around your own environment.
If you want a more standards-based sharing model, the TAXII API may be a better fit.
Explore next
- Want a standards-based sharing option? See TAXII API.
- Want a connector-based path into a CTI platform? See OpenCTI Integration.
- Want a portable export format for downstream CTI systems? See STIX Bundle Export.
- Want the broader workflow view? See Integrate Stixify into Your Security Stack and AI Workflows.
